Abstract
We participate in a NEDO project called C0URSE50 (CO_2 Ultimate Reduction in Steelmaking process by innovative technology for cool Earth 50), in which we aim to apply HPC as a caking additive to make high strength coke for the blast furnace, which maximize the use of hydrogen as a reductant, in order to minimize carbon addition to the furnace. In this study, we investigated the effect of HPC addition on coke strength after reaction using spherical coke. Coke strength after reaction tended to be higher by HPC addition in both reactions of Boudouard reaction and water gas reaction at the same reaction conversion. Those effects were confirmed by measurement of the coke diameter after reaction.
